Competitions Update

The latter stages of the CDSA competitions are approaching, so we thought we’d take a look at who’s made it through in the four tournaments –

Cardiff Open Singles

The quarter-finals of the CDSA’s most prestigious competition have been decided, with some big names including defending champion Rhys Carpenter ready to battle it out –

Graeme Prance v James Wigmore

Kyle Patterson v Jason Hewitt

Sam Thomas v Twm Jones

Rhys Carpenter v Dan Bridle

Cardiff Open Pairs

The quarter-finals are looking very close to call with 2018 champions Allen & Hurley potentially on course to meet 2014 winners Rowlands & Thomas in the final, but the other six pairs will all fancy their chances of a spot in the final –

Ryan Rowlands/Sam Thomas v Terry Garland/Steffan Davies

Tom Cross/Kevin Brown v Shaun O’Connell/Ben Griffiths

Ronnie Allen/Alan Hurley v Dave Earls/John Hicks

Simon Takata/Syed Moshin Kazmi v Martyn Evans/Dave Standage

Cardiff Handicap Singles

The final of this competition is already decided after the rounds were played earlier to alleviate a build-up of fixtures for people later in the year, with both finalists winning their semi-final 3-0 –

Kevin Davies v Ben Griffiths

Cardiff Handicap Pairs

The semi-finalists are decided in this competition with the following facing off for a place in the final –

Jason Hewitt/Simon Parker v James Wigmore/Kieran Madden

Steve Wellbeloved/Clive Marsh v Ryan Rowlands/Sam Thomas
